Define the cleaning effects of innovative proprietary ultrasonic technology.
Additionally, the pollution particles are dispersed in the cleaning liquid. By this, a new adhesion to the material to be cleaned is ignored and the particles are flushed away. By the utilization of an innovative proprietary ultrasonic technology, extremely strong cavitations fields are produced, so that very good cleaning effects at high line speeds can be accomplished. When the cleaning effect is based onto the physical cleaning consequences of the ultrasound, this can be used for any ferrous and non-ferrous material, for example stainless steel, aluminum, copper but also glass or plastic. Most usually ultrasonic cleaning machines are utilized for drawn wire, for illustrations before cladding or extrusion. With the concentration of the ultrasonic power to a low liquid volume, an extremely compact design can be realized. It can be simply integrated in existing or new production lines, for example directly after drawing or reel payoff.
